Love and Rockets #2

Apr 1983 · Fantagraphics · 2.95 USD; 3.50 CAD
“Mechanics”

In "Mechanics," the Polaris Apartments become a crossroads for the bizarre and desperate: a deposed alien king seeking refuge, a drug dealer with a personal vendetta, and a mysterious figure named Zezbar trying to escape his own dimension. Written by the Hernandez brothers and illustrated with sharp, expressive detail by Mario Hernandez, this issue blends surreal humor and quiet tension in a story that unfolds with the grounded chaos of everyday life, elevated by the strange. The cover, by Jaime Hernandez, captures the moment’s uneasy energy.

Full plot ⚠ may contain spoilers

▸ Reveal full plot — may contain spoilers

Aliens, the deposed King of Marzipan and drug dealers all are at the Polaris Apartments. Zezbar is trying to get to his own dimension, King Svedor looks for asylum and Mosca arrives to settle a score.
